Transaction

75c87cebddd16c3f0806689ec7f58fe772d94fcaa131af23c80b3ee3f241b8ec

Summary

In Block718051
TimeWed, 29 May 2024 11:38:15 UTC
Total Input694.44583333 Nebula
Total Output728.44583333 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
180130 Confirmations728.44583333 Nebula
Raw Transaction